Notes
on
dual
power
feed
setting
The
power
supply
unit
of
the
SPARC
M10
system
is
redundantly
configured.
Enabling
or
disabling
the
dual
power
feed
function
with
the
setdualpowerfeed(8)
command
does
not
affect
the
behavior
of
a
redundantly
configured
system.
Therefore,
when
the
display
results
of
the
showdualpowerfeed(8)
and
showhardconf
(8)
commands,
which
are
dependent
on
the
setting
of
the
setdualpowerfeed(8)
command,
also
fall
under
any
of
the
following
conditions,
the
behavior
of
the
redundantly
configured
system
is
not
affected.
The
showhardconf(8)
command
displays
"Power_Supply_System:
Dual;"
when
the
showdualpowerfeed(8)
command
displays
"Dual
power
feed
is
enabled."
The
showhardconf(8)
command
displays
"Power_Supply_System:
Single;"
when
the
showdualpowerfeed(8)
command
displays
"Dual
power
feed
is
disabled."
The
system
administrator
can
use
this
setting
function
as
a
memo
for
determining
whether
the
power
supply
unit
has
a
dual
power
feed
configuration.
Notes
on
Active
Directory
If
Active
Directory
is
enabled
and
you
try
login
via
telnet,
inquiry
to
the
second
and
subsequent
alternative
servers
may
time
out,
causing
the
login
to
fail.
If
the
value
set
by
the
timeout
operand
of
the
setad(8)
command
is
small,
and
you
log
in
to
the
XSCF,
the
user
privilege
may
not
be
assigned
to
you.
In
this
case,
increase
the
timeout
setting
value
and
try
again.
Notes
on
LDAP
over
SSL
If
the
value
set
by
the
timeout
operand
of
the
setldapssl(8)
command
is
small,
and
you
log
in
to
the
XSCF,
the
user
privilege
may
not
be
assigned
to
you.
In
this
case,
increase
the
timeout
setting
value
and
try
again.
